Mousseux Sobre – Alkoholfrei
Tasting note
This unique sparkling Malanser grape must is refined with an infusion of Japanese green tea, as well as various spices and herbs. The tea imparts subtle tannins and blends perfectly with the grape juice to create a harmonious aroma. On the palate, it offers a wonderful combination of subtle sweetness, lively acidity and fine effervescence.

Description
We have developed a tea recipe that perfectly complements our grape juice, together with the dream team of Franziska Wölfle (hostess and mixologist) and Marcel Koolen (head chef) from the ‘7132 Silver’ restaurant in Vals.
Grape Variety
60% Gewürztraminer and 40% Chardonnay. The Gewürztraminer imparts a wonderful aroma to the Sobre, while the early-harvested Chardonnay provides a mineral and juicy structure.
Vineyard
Ratschelga and Selviteiler. Georg and Ruth planted the old Gewürztraminer vines in the Ratschelga vineyard in 1982. The younger Chardonnay vines in the Selviteiler vineyard were planted in 2018.
Soil
The Ratschelga vineyard is located at our original site, right in the heart of the village. Our highest vineyard, at 590 metres, is characterised by slate, limestone and magnetite. The Selviteiler vineyard (531 m) has a soil made up of loam and sand.
Viticulture
We cultivate our vines using natural, holistic methods. In accordance with the principles of regenerative agriculture, we use various seeds and compost teas, and we are certified organic by Bio-Suisse and Knospe.
Maturation
A sparkling fusion of Malans grape juice, Japanese green tea, pink pepper, Earl Grey tea, rose petals, Ancho chilli and verbena.
